Webb12 sep. 2006 · Personally I would cut it out in the basement and run new copper to the edge of the deck and put a new spigot there. Hopefully you have a valve inside for winterization. If you want to leave the existing spigot, you can get a female garden hose to 1/2" npt fitting and then sweat copper out to the edge of the deck and attach your spigot … Webb1 mars 2024 · With flexible bag-style hose bib covers, just put it over the spigot and tighten the drawstring. Resources: The spare washer kit, teflon tape, and spigot repair tools can all be found at home centers and … Webb22 maj 2024 · Remove the old outdoor water faucet sill cock by positioning a pipe wrench at the back of the sill cock and turning the wrench counterclockwise. Have an assistant use a pipe wrench to hold back the sill cock supply line inside to prevent sections of pipe from unscrewing.
